Match funding
Companies often match the amount their employees donate to or raise for charity. So please ask your employer or your HR team if they run such a scheme as it could double the amount your donations!

Payroll giving
It is a great way to make your money go further, and a regular donation to the Royal Wolverhampton School Foundation costs less than you think!  Donations are taken from your pay before tax.  If you pledge to give £10 a month, it will only cost you £8 (for standard rate taxpayer). BE EVENTFUL

Whether at work or with friends, the possibilities are endless - the main thing is to have fun!

  • Hold a sport tournament.  Encourage healthy competition across departments whilst team building!  Netball, football, etc – choose one to suit all abilities. Get each player to donate as an entry fee.
  • Host a quiz night.  A fun night out and an easy way to raise money!
  • Dress-down day: hold a dress-down (or up!) day at work and ask your colleagues to donate £1 to take part.  It works on Zoom/Teams for those of you working from home.
  • Card amnesty: get your friends to send you a donation instead of a card or present for your birthday.
  • Virtual karaoke contest: for these “only in the shower” singers, sing to your heart content, all in the name of charity and from the comfort of your own home!
  • Come Dine with Me: invite a group of friends over for dinner and ask them to donate whatever they think the meal was worth to the Royal Wolverhampton School Foundation. 
  • Auction of services: get people to auction their services e.g., personal trainer, chef for a week, beauty therapy.
